How Avalon Towers Bellevue Actually Works

Living at Avalon Towers Bellevue is straightforward for eligible renters. The process starts with an online application via the official leasing portal, where you submit income verification, credit check, and references. Approval typically takes 24-48 hours, with flexible lease terms from 6 to 18 months.

The towers feature studio to three-bedroom units, many with floor-to-ceiling windows offering city or mountain vistas. Standard inclusions are stainless steel appliances, in-unit washers/dryers, and smart home tech like keyless entry.

Community perks drive daily life: a resort-style pool, 24/7 fitness center, yoga studio, and resident lounge for events. Concierge services handle package delivery and maintenance requests seamlessly. Pet owners appreciate the dog park and spacious leashes-free zones. Monthly fees cover most utilities except internet, keeping operations efficient and resident-focused.

What Are the Rental Prices at Avalon Towers Bellevue?

Rates vary by unit size and season, generally starting around $2,500 for studios and reaching $6,000+ for larger layouts. Market fluctuations and promotions can adjust these—check current listings for deals.

Is Avalon Towers Bellevue Pet-Friendly?

Yes, with policies allowing two pets per unit (dogs up to 75 lbs, cats welcome). Fees apply, and there's an on-site pet spa for convenience.

How's the Commute from Avalon Towers Bellevue?

It's commuter heaven: Light rail to Seattle in 20 minutes, easy drives to I-405, and bike paths everywhere. Remote workers love the quiet yet connected setup.

What Amenities Stand Out at Avalon Towers Bellevue?

Beyond basics, enjoy a sky lounge with BBQs, co-working spaces, and electric vehicle charging. Seasonal events foster community without overwhelming schedules.
